Getting There

  • Walking

    From most hotels in Digha, the View Point is easily accessible by walking along Sea Beach Road. The walk offers scenic views of the coastline. Remember to stay aware of local traffic.

  • Public Transport

    Cycle-vans and motor vans are readily available throughout Digha and can take you to the View Point. A short trip within Digha typically costs ₹5-₹10 per person. Negotiate the fare before starting your journey.

  • Taxi/Ride-Share

    Auto-rickshaws and app-based cabs are available from the Digha bus stand and railway station. A short taxi ride to Digha View Point will typically cost around ₹50-₹100. Confirm the fare with the driver beforehand.

Discover more about Digha View Point

Digha View Point is a prime location for experiencing the expansive beauty of Digha's coastline. Situated along Sea Beach Road in Gadadharpur, it provides unobstructed views of the Bay of Bengal, making it a favorite spot for both locals and tourists. The viewpoint is ideally visited during the early morning to witness a splendid sunrise, or in the evening to enjoy the tranquil sunset views. The atmosphere is generally pleasant, with a constant sea breeze adding to the experience. While the watch point offers interesting views, some visitors have noted a noticeable fish smell in the area. Digha itself has a rich history, initially known as Beerkul and later recognized by Warren Hastings as the 'Brighton of the East'. The development of Digha as a tourist destination was significantly influenced by John Frank Snaith, who encouraged the Chief Minister of West Bengal to develop the area into a beach resort. Today, Digha is a bustling sea resort with attractions like New Digha Beach, Marine Aquarium, and Amarabati Park, making it a well-rounded destination for travelers.
